Embarking on your journey towards economic freedom can seem daunting, but with a clear roadmap, it's entirely achievable. First, determine your current budgetary situation – track income and expenses diligently to understand where your money is going. Next, create a realistic budget that prioritizes allocating funds. Then, start paying off high-interest debt like credit cards; this frees up cash flow for further investment. Simultaneously, build an emergency fund—aiming for 3-6 months of living expenses offers a crucial safety net. Afterward, consider growing wealth in diversified assets such as stocks, bonds, and real estate, taking into account your risk tolerance and long-term goals. This approach involves aggressively investing a significant portion of your income – often 50% or more - to build up a substantial nest egg, allowing you to stop working much earlier than the conventional retirement age. However, achieving FIRE requires immense discipline, meticulous budgeting, and a willingness to make sacrifices. It’s not simply about having lots of money; it's about strategically minimizing your expenses and maximizing your investments to reach a point where your assets generate enough income to cover your living costs. This involves more than just saving money; it's about leveraging your investments. Consider a diversified portfolio that blends low-cost index mutual funds with carefully selected individual stocks, potentially including real estate or other alternative assets. Regularly rebalancing is key to maintaining your desired asset allocation, and remember to factor in tax-advantaged accounts like 401(k)s or IRAs for maximum advantage. Don’t overlook the power of dividend reinvestment – letting those earnings work for you can significantly accelerate your progress toward financial independence. This guide presents a clear plan for shifting from the typical “work-until-you-die” mindset. It involves aggressively accumulating a substantial sum of money – typically 25 times your annual expenses - which then generates enough passive income to cover those costs, allowing you to quit traditional employment. We’ll explore key areas like calculating your FIRE number, optimizing your savings rate (often above 50%), slashing unnecessary expenditures, and intelligently allocating investments to maximize growth while mitigating risk.
